Responsibilities / What You Will Do
* Install, repair, and maintain Siemens Healthineers medical systems as part of a field-based engineering team of about 200 engineers across Great Britain & Ireland.
* Provide essential technical service support to customers at hospital sites across the UK, initially focusing on London and the South England region.
* Attend local college to work towards Level 3 in Mechatronic Engineering, progressing to Level 4, during a four-year apprenticeship.
* Visit customer sites, Siemens manufacturing sites, and training centres in Germany and the US.
* Gain hands-on experience diagnosing and repairing complex mechanical and electrical issues on high-tech medical products.
* Upon successful completion, have the opportunity to apply for a permanent full-time Customer Service Engineer role with opportunities for further education and product training.

Benefits
* Starting salary £15,000 - £19,950 (age dependent) with generous annual performance-based increases and potential overtime.
* A van for business use during the apprenticeship and fuel costs covered by the company.
* £500 fund for driving lessons, theory test, and practical test fees if you do not yet have a driving license; a full UK driving license is expected within the first 9 months.
You will need at least four GCSEs at grade 4 (or C) or above, including English Language and Maths.
Eligibility
You will also need to meet the UK Government's Apprenticeship eligibility criteria:
* Have been a UK/EU/EAA resident for the past three years or more prior to starting the course
* Have left full-time education when the apprenticeship you are applying for is due to start
* Be aged at least 16 years old to meet government funding criteria
